Output 66dfa61551a899fbff2812eb30d4266f28bb8e5df113c2f30c9f87f774b5065f:0

value
143937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38323a947ebc3f7ec4993d25d937b7957255c40 OP_EQUAL
address
3NRzQooJm9QYg2YrtCvHjrgCFfyCcCkY3B
transaction
66dfa61551a899fbff2812eb30d4266f28bb8e5df113c2f30c9f87f774b5065f